SEA BASS WITH ONION AND CUMIN SAUCE

Categories     Citrus     Fish     Onion     Tomato     Bass     Halibut     Healthy     Bon Appétit

Yield Serves 4

Number Of Ingredients 7



Sea Bass with Onion and Cumin Sauce image

Steps:

  • Place fish in glass baking dish. Pour lemon juice over. Season with salt and pepper. Chill while preparing sauce.
  • Blanch tomatoes in pot of boiling water for 20 seconds. Drain. Peel tomatoes. Cut tomatoes in half; squeeze out seeds. Chop tomatoes; set aside.
  • Heat oil in heavy large skillet over medium heat. Add onions, cover and cook until soft and golden brown, stirring occasionally, about 20 minutes. Add garlic and sauté 30 seconds. Mix in cumin, then tomatoes. Simmer sauce 5 minutes. Add fish with lemon juice and simmer until fish is just cooked through, about 10 minutes.
  • Using slotted spatula, transfer fish to platter. Boil sauce in skillet until slightly thickened, about 5 minutes. Season to taste with salt and pepper. Spoon sauce over fish.

4 6-ounce sea bass or halibut fillets (1 inch thick)
1/4 cup fresh lemon juice
1 pound tomatoes
3 tablespoons vegetable oil
2 large onions, cut into 1/4-inch-thick slices
4 garlic cloves, pressed
1 1/2 teaspoons ground cumin

CHILEAN SEA BASS MOHO AND MORE

Categories     Fish     Vegetable     Bake     Quick & Easy     Bass     Spring     Parade

Yield Makes 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 15



Chilean Sea Bass Moho and More image

Steps:

  • 1. Prepare the Moho Sauce: Mix the garlic and onion in a small bowl with the cumin, salt, and pepper. Place the oil in a small, heavy saucepan over low heat. Add the onion mixture and cook, stirring, for 10 minutes or until translucent. Add the lime juice and vinegar, then simmer over medium-low heat for 5 minutes. (Makes 2/3 cup.)
  • 2. Halve the sea bass fillets crosswise (into 8-ounce pieces).
  • 3. In a shallow bowl, whisk the lime juice with 3 tablespoons of the olive oil, salt, pepper, and garlic. Add the fish and coat well. Marinate for 15 minutes. Remove and pat dry.
  • 4. Preheat the oven to 450°F.
  • 5. With a very sharp knife, score the skin side of the fish twice diagonally to prevent curling.
  • 6. Place the remaining 2 tablespoons of olive oil in a nonstick skillet. Sear the fish, skin-side down, over medium heat, holding the fillets down with a spatula until the skin is crispy and golden brown.
  • 7. Remove fish to an ovenproof dish or skillet and bake in the oven for 8 to 10 minutes, or until cooked through.
  • 8. Meanwhile, set the Moho Sauce over very low heat and gently heat through.
  • 9. Peel and slice the avocado in half lengthwise, remove the pit and slice each half into thin slices lengthwise.
  • 10. To serve, place a fish fillet in the center of each of 4 dinner plates. Spoon 1 to 2 tablespoons of Moho Sauce atop each fillet. Fan 3 or 4 slices of avocado atop each serving and sprinkle with chopped cilantro. Place a bowl of the extra cilantro and a bowl of Moho Sauce on the table.

For the Moho Sauce:
4 large cloves of garlic, peeled and thinly sliced lengthwise
1/4 cup thinly slivered onion
1/2 teaspoon ground cumin
Salt and freshly ground black pepper, to taste
3 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
6 tablespoons fresh lime juice
1/2 teaspoon white-wine vinegar
2 fillets of Chilean sea bass (about 1 pound each)
4 tablespoons fresh lime juice
5 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
Salt and freshly ground black pepper, to taste
2 large cloves of garlic, peeled and pressed
1 ripe avocado, for serving
3/4 cup coarsely chopped fresh cilantro leaves, for serving

SEA BASS WITH SIZZLED GINGER, CHILLI & SPRING ONIONS

The aromas released while cooking this dish will have everyone licking their lips in anticipation

Provided by Jane Hornby

Categories     Dinner, Main course

Time 25m

Number Of Ingredients 7



Sea bass with sizzled ginger, chilli & spring onions image

Steps:

  • Season 6 sea bass fillets with salt and pepper, then slash the skin 3 times.
  • Heat a heavy-based frying pan and add 1 tbsp sunflower oil.
  • Once hot, fry the sea bass fillets, skin-side down, for 5 mins or until the skin is very crisp and golden. The fish will be almost cooked through.
  • Turn over, cook for another 30 seconds - 1 minute, then transfer to a serving plate and keep warm. You'll need to fry the sea bass fillets in 2 batches.
  • Heat 2 tbsp sunflower oil, then fry the large knob of peeled ginger, cut into matchsticks, 3 thinly sliced garlic cloves and 3 thinly shredded red chillies for about 2 mins until golden.
  • Take off the heat and toss in the bunch of shredded spring onions. Splash the fish with 1 tbsp soy sauce and spoon over the contents of the pan.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 202 calories, Fat 9 grams fat, SaturatedFat 1 grams saturated fat, Carbohydrate 2 grams carbohydrates, Sugar 1 grams sugar, Protein 28 grams protein, Sodium 0.26 milligram of sodium

6 x sea bass fillets, about 140g/5oz each, skin on and scaled
about 3 tbsp sunflower oil
large knob of ginger, peeled and shredded into matchsticks
3 garlic cloves, thinly sliced
3 fat, fresh red chillies deseeded and thinly shredded
bunch spring onion, shredded long-ways
1 tbsp soy sauce

BAKED SEA BASS WITH POTATOES, TOMATOES AND ONIONS

Provided by Mark Bittman

Categories     dinner, weekday, main course

Time 1h

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 10



Baked Sea Bass With Potatoes, Tomatoes and Onions image

Steps:

  • Heat the oven to 350. Drizzle 2 tablespoons of the oil in the bottom of a large roasting pan. Spread half the potatoes in the pan in a single layer, followed by half the tomatoes and half the onions. Sprinkle with salt and pepper, and repeat the layers. Scatter the garlic, thyme and rosemary on top and drizzle with 3 tablespoons of the oil. Cover the pan with foil and bake for 1 hour.
  • Meanwhile, rinse the fish with cold water to remove any blood or traces of viscera. Make three deep, parallel crosswise cuts on each side of each fish. Sprinkle inside and out with salt and pepper. Uncover the roasting pan and lay the fish on top of the vegetables. Raise the oven temperature to 375. Bake until the fish is opaque and flakes easily near its backbone, and the potatoes are fork tender, about 15 to 20 minutes. Drizzle with the remaining tablespoon oil, garnish with more thyme and rosemary sprigs and serve.

Nutrition Facts : @context http, Calories 492, UnsaturatedFat 13 grams, Carbohydrate 50 grams, Fat 17 grams, Fiber 8 grams, Protein 39 grams, SaturatedFat 3 grams, Sodium 1327 milligrams, Sugar 7 grams

6 tablespoons olive oil
6 medium all-purpose potatoes, peeled and cut into 1/2-inch slices
6 medium ripe tomatoes, cored and cut into 1/4-inch slices
3 medium onions, thinly sliced
Salt
Black pepper
9 unpeeled garlic cloves, crushed
6 fresh thyme sprigs, plus more for garnish
6 fresh rosemary sprigs, plus more for garnish
6 whole small sea bass or other fish about 4 pounds total, scaled and gutted
